Probably more paypal headaches for Taiwan users
 
Got this email from Paypal:

Dear Joe Blow

Due to regulatory changes in Taiwan, we will be changing the way you can withdraw funds from your PayPal account. We are happy to announce that we have partnered with E.SUN Bank to create a new way to get your funds into your bank account faster. Our partnership with E.SUN Bank will enable you to withdraw both New Taiwan Dollars and US dollars into your E.SUN Bank account through E.SUN Global Pass.

As of March 31, 2014, users in Taiwan will need to have an E.SUN Bank account and link it to their PayPal account through E.SUN Global Pass in order to process withdrawals. We recommend that you visit your nearest E.SUN Bank branch at your earliest convenience to open an E.SUN Bank account and enable online banking service before March 31 2014.

Here’s how to get started:

1. Open an E.SUN Bank account (TWD or USD bank account, depending on which currency you wish to receive) and ensure that you have enabled the E.SUN online banking service. You can visit E.SUN’s website for more details.
2. Effective from March 31, you can log in to the E.SUN online banking website and access the PayPal withdrawal service E.SUN Global Pass, then follow the instructions to link your PayPal account.
